Output c98323cce31f541a6a176b01e6eec5e07f32d95f4bd0d9de1141e322d5509556:0

value
186568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a13362c2b003adde077bf2588d99835a102d6089 OP_EQUAL
address
3GPNGmvEEUCBZNAd5FBPkiATtABUGSN1vG
transaction
c98323cce31f541a6a176b01e6eec5e07f32d95f4bd0d9de1141e322d5509556
confirmations
231464
spent
true